Unitech sells 10 acres of land for Rs 100-130 crore

11 Mar 2014 Evaluate

In a bid to repay its debt, realty major Unitech has sold almost 10 acres of land in Bangalore and Mysore for about Rs 100-130 crore. These land parcels were non-core assets for the company.

At present, the company has debt of about Rs 6,200 crore, including Rs 150-200 crore from Life Insurance Corporation of India (LIC).

In January, Unitech was looking to sell plots in south India for about Rs 400 crore and had planned to divest two hotels in Noida and Gurgaon for an estimated Rs 600 crore.
